    Oportunidad comercial de Colombia para exportar guayaba pera a Estados Unidos
    Palomar-Cifuentes, Laura Andrea; Joya-Cogua, Diana Carolina; Aguilar-Galeano, Estibaliz
    The purpose of this project is to determine what is the commercial opportunity that Colombia has to export pear guava to the United States market. For this research, a qualitative approach and a descriptive type of research were used, in order to collect information independently. We worked under the model of Porter's competitive advantage theory, which provided the basis to identify through the production factors the strengths, opportunities, weaknesses and threats that the object of study may have, after which they were evaluated the current demand and competition conditions to export pear guava to the United States. As a result, it was found that Colombia has relevant strengths and opportunities to reach the US market, taking as a first that the United States is a demanding market and must comply with phytosanitary and security measures and arguably the most demanding customs regulations worldwide. The results obtained show that Colombia has had significant growth in the last four years, thanks to commercial alliances such as TLC, Export opportunities and the demand for fruits in this country grows rapidly every day, the United States is a demanding market and Colombia must improve and acquire experience and knowledge at a technical and commercial level to be competitive with other countries with this type of product.
